In her conversation with Roland Today, Jill Sidoti talks about how she helps entrepreneurs figure out how to raise capital legally. If you need to raise money for your business, then this episode will be a great start to help you understand which direction you need to head in, so that you can stay legal, stay out of prison, and get the money you need. “I think it’s really important that we allow mom and pop investors, to invest in new entrepreneurial endeavors so that they’re not just available for the venture capital angel investors. But there has to be proper disclosure to those investors. Those investors have to be treated properly within the law”. Jill Sidoti Jillian Sidoti is an attorney, speaker, entrepreneur, mama, and former college professor. Forever focused on finding the best and least challenging path for entrepreneurs to find funding for their deals. Jillian has written equity and debt offerings for all kinds of industries, including real estate, biotech, film, software, alcoholic beverage, cannabis, and green tech. She also has a book which you can get here. “You can pay me like a little now, or you can pay me a lot later, to help you get out of trouble with the S.E.C. And there’s no guarantee I’m going to be able to get you out of trouble”. Jill Sidoti. Listen Today For, What is ‘Regulation A’? “Regulation A is one of the new crowdfunding laws that allow companies to raise up to $50 million, and raise money from anybody”. Why you want to go after people in your current network before you go out anywhere else. “The money we know is that is way better than money the money we don’t know”. Jill Sidoni. The difference between Regulation A and Regulation D, and how that affects you if you’re trying to raise money from private investors. Why a company might work under Regulation A when it costs more money and takes more time. “Normally, if somebody comes to me and says, Hey, I want to do a Regulation A offering, then I kind of put them through the wringer first to see if they a critical mass in some way, shape or form. Or do you have something so novel that you marketing the opportunity it’s definitely going get your money through the door.” • Why you need the Marketing element and the legal element to raise money. “If you have the legal element, that’s great, but it doesn’t do any good if you don’t have the marketing element. And if you have the marketing element but you don’t have the legal element. I mean, you risk going to prison”. Jill Sidoti Plus, • Resources for you to learn more. Jillian Sidoti, Esq. is one of the country's leading experts on Regulation A+. Since 2008, Jillian has submitted multiple Regulation A Offering Circulars to the Securities Exchange Commission for approval making her one of the few attorneys familiar with the law prior to the changes under the JOBS Act. Since the JOBS Act, Jillian has assisted multiple companies and entrepreneurs realize their fundraising goals through Crowdfunding, 506©, and Regulation A. Jillian also continues to specialize in transactional legal matters such as private placement memorandums, S-1′s/S-11's, and Regulation D filings. Jillian also spends her time speaking at seminars educating real estate investors on how to legally raise capital for their real estate investment projects. Jillian is the author of the highly rated book, The Crowdfunding Myth which debunks the multiple myths surrounding crowdfunding and teaches the reader how to effectively crowdfund their securities offering. Prior to her legal career, Jillian owned and operated a record label enabling her to tour worldwide with artists, including visiting South Africa, Canada, Europe, and the United States. Using that experience, Jillian has been commissioned to write articles and contracts for many music industry entities. For several years, Jillian taught Finance and Accounting for the BS and MBA programs at the University of Redlands, drawing on her experience as Financial Analyst, Controller, and CFO for many companies from manufacturing to real estate development. Making properties perform without raising rent is a special skill and one that is becoming increasingly important in the current moment of crisis. As rental income is growing more and more uncertain, it is essential to find other ways to generate revenue. Jason Yarusi is an asset management superhero, and he is here today to share some of his knowledge with us. In this episode, we learn more about property triage and ways to cut back the fat. Jason discusses his ‘water walk' and how, through tenant education and simple upgrades, he has been able to cut back on his properties' water expenditure significantly. We also discuss how interventions in common areas, like unnecessary lighting or electricity use, can save significant costs in the long-run. Jason highlights the importance of sidelining any non-urgent capital expenditure and why it's necessary to be as conservative as possible.---Our gracious sponsor: Gene Trowbridge and Jillian Sidoti, founding partners of the top syndication law firm Trowbridge Sidoti, have a legal team with over 88 years of combined legal experience. There’s often great uncertainty around raising money for deals, but breaching the associated laws has serious ramifications, which is why it is important to have an in-depth understanding of them. Today's guest, Jillian Sidoti, is her to clarify some of the misconceptions around raising capital with a focus on 506(c) deals. Jillian is one of the country’s leading Regulation A experts. Since 2008, she has submitted many Regulation A offering circulars to the SEC for approval, which makes her one of the few attorneys familiar with the law before the changes under the Jobs Act. Since then, Jillian has helped multiple companies and entrepreneurs fulfill their fundraising goals through crowdfunding 506(c) and Regulation A. In this episode we learn more about how the 2008 crash led Jillian down the path of crowdfunding and why she has chosen to help clients in this way. She also sheds light on the 506(c) parameters and stipulations for accredited investors. While this ‘open’ way of raising capital might seem simple, it is important to build a trustworthy brand to secure investors. Jillian shares some tips on how to do this, along with effective communication advice and much more. Be sure to tune in today!Key Points From This Episode:Learn about Jillian’s background and how she’s merged her real estate and legal skills.Why Jillian has chosen to remain a passive investor rather than an active one.An explanation of 506(c) offerings and what it means to be an accredited investor.What investors need to know when opting in on a 506(c) deal.The importance of building a trustworthy brand to get investors for a deal.Why it could be a problem to do a 506(b) offering very soon after a 506(c) one.Jillian’s tips on how to get investors for a 506(c) and the best way to communicate with them.Find out why asking for money over the internet before building trust is ineffective.The importance of staying in the law when raising capital and what happens if you don’t.Final five questions with Jillian: Advice for women, tools she can’t go without, and more!Tweetables:“Under 506(c), we can advertise, but all of our investors have to be those accredited investors.” — Jillian Sidoti [0:05:13]“Money that knows you is always better than money that doesn't know you.” — Jillian Sidoti [0:06:44]“Don’t wait until you have a deal to start getting people to understand who you are and what your brand is.” — Jillian Sidoti [0:12:28]Links Mentioned in Today’s Episode:Jillian SidotiJillian Sidoti on LinkedInThe Crowdfunding MythCrowdfunding LawyersCrowdfunding Lawyers on FacebookSECGrant CardoneLeapfunderWefunderRich UnclesAsset Protection Attorney Wayne PattonWayne Patton’s phone numberPassive Income through Multifamily Real Estate group on FacebookLalita Mitchell on FacebookKyle Mitchell on FacebookLimitless Estates

Back in 2012, the JOBS Act was passed. What we have seen happen is that more people are now advertising for investors because there’s a couple of different rules that allow you to advertise for investors. One of those rules is 506c which allows you to raise money from accredited investors only. You can do general solicitation, but you have to verify that those investors that are coming in your deals are indeed accredited. On this episode, Scott talks with attorney Jillian Sidoti about some common crowdfunding mistakes and ways to legally raise private capital. Love the show? Subscribe, rate, review, and share!
